🏢 What kind of company is Dyadic International?

Dyadic International is a US-based biotech company that centers its business on the C1 protein production platform for protein-based biopharmaceutical manufacturing. The company focuses on technology validation and collaborative development aimed at improving process efficiency for recombinant proteins, vaccine antigens, and antibody production.

The core business is validating the production feasibility of recombinant proteins, vaccine antigens, monoclonal antibodies, therapeutic proteins, and enzymes using the C1 platform. The company outlines a commercialization path that runs in parallel with partner development, commercial production collaborations, platform and strain licensing, royalties, and product sales.

💰 How does Dyadic International make money?

Business SegmentRevenue MixDescription
Platform DevelopmentCore ActivityC1 technology validation and process development for biopharmaceutical manufacturing
Partnership ProgramsExpandingVerifying applicability through partner research and joint development

Dyadic International's revenue flow does not depend solely on a single product sale; it is shaped by the progress of platform validation and partnership programs. Partner-funded development, production collaborations, technology licensing, royalties, and product sales form multiple commercialization paths, and the conversion speed of each path can lead to significant earnings volatility. Expanding the range of applications such as recombinant proteins and vaccine antigens helps diversify the business, but it remains necessary to verify whether research-stage results translate into repeatable manufacturing demand.

In the near term, the pace of research collaborations and the development demand funded by partners can affect earnings visibility. Over the medium to long term, the key to growth is whether the production efficiency of the C1 platform is validated for recombinant proteins, vaccine antigens, antibodies, and therapeutic enzymes, and whether it leads to commercial manufacturing collaborations. However, biopharmaceutical development and the adoption of new manufacturing processes involve long validation periods and can be affected by regulation, partner priorities, and the technical progress of competing platforms. Uncertainty in the process of converting contracts and licenses into recurring revenue is also a volatility factor.
